The air on Monday was cold and damp, a fitting start to a week of reckoning. The training ground, once filled with laughter and light-hearted banter, had turned somber.
The players arrived in silence, their expressions marked by a grim determination. The emotional and physical toll of the weekend was still written across their faces.
Dev Patel was the first to step onto the pitch, moving with a sense of urgency unfamiliar even to him.
Without a word, he headed straight for the corner flag, grabbed a handful of balls, and began drilling crosses each one sharper than the last, his jaw clenched in focus.
He knew his mistake had played out in front of everyone, and he was determined to put it right.
Niels stood off to the side, a steaming cup of coffee in hand, watching in silence. He hadn't addressed the players yet letting the chill in the air and the heavy quiet speak for him.
